Grants paid by The Steinbrenner Family Foundation Inc, tax year 2022

EIN 61-1517634 · Tampa, FL · Form 990-PF, Part XV · NTEE T22

In tax year 2022, The Steinbrenner Family Foundation Inc (EIN 61-1517634) reported 10 grants paid totaling $682,000. Dataset version 2026.09.0, built 2026-09-03.
